Why does my Association need a website?

To state your presence
Make the existence of your association known to the search engine, online maps, and professional directories.
Introduce yourself to the Tribe
Before anyone joins your professional association or an interest group they would need to know who you are, what is your mission and vision, and what activities and resources you offer.
Serve your Members
Promote events, share news updates, post important information, make available useful resources.
What Information and Features are commonly found on an Association’s website?
Missions and Vision
News Updates
List of Board Members
Member Resources
Events
Information on how to join
History
Donation Form
Membership Subscription
Job Offerings
Advertisement Opportunities
Mailing List
